MATCH REVIEW: Newtown 6-1 Aberystwyth

Newtown ended their Welsh Premier League regular season with a thumping 6-1 victory of their local rivals Aberystwyth Town. 

The Mid Wales rivals went head to head in the final round of games in Pbase Two, and it was the Robins who came out the dominant victors. 

In an exciting opening 10 minutes, both sides exchanged free kicks with four good opportunities arising, but neither side could make the most of them and put their mark on the game. 

Despite recent struggles in the league, it was the Seasiders who posed the greatest threat in the opening periods, but Newtown’s stern defence proved difficult o break down.  

A goal very nearly came from a Cledan Davies corner, but after Chris Hughes’s men finally cleared the danger.

However, it was the hosts who opened the scoring, on their way to a 6-1 tour. With a fantastic shot after 19 minutes, Nick Rushton opened the scoring.

The second came only four minutes later. After Daniel Alfei was caught out of position, Stef Edwards capitalised and doubled the home side’s lead. 

And the Robins really finished off the visitors, as they scored their third goal in seven minutes. Ryan Kershaw added the final touches to provide Newtown clear breathing space.  

Mullock pulled off a spectacular save in the 36th minute to deny their rivals, as Wayne Jones’ side headed into the break 3-0 down. 

In the second half, Aber came out much more threatening and could have reduced the defective, but were denied by the woodworm three times. 

And their chances of a comeback were scuppered just seven minutes into the second half, when Luke Boundford scored Newtown’s fourth.
The goal confirmed that the floodgates had well and truly opened. With freedom and creativity in the final third, Newtown forward Rushron added two more to grab a hat-trick for his side. 

Aberystwyth netted a mere consolation goal when young center back Siôn Ewart was introduced into the fray and eased home. 
A dismal end to the season for Aberystwyth but a fantastic end for Newtown. After very opposing seasons, Newtown’s Phase Two revival was completed at Latham Park as their resounding victory sees them head into the Welsh Premier League European Play-offs full of confidence.
